Selecting Machining Method Based on Fuzzy Comprehensive Evaluation

Machining method influences the processing cost directly.Fuzzy comprehensive evaluation method is used to select the optimum machining technological design scheme from the multitudinous alternatives based on the analysis of three main influence factors, such as machining quality, machining cost and machining efficiency, which influence the process of technological design directly. One desirable membership function and one fuzzy comprehensive evaluation model of multi-process designing schemes are designed, and one approach of multi-process schemes decision making process is presented. Finally, one fuzzy comprehensive evaluation machining method decision making system is developed with MA I LAB, and the result of the case study indicates the evaluation results accord with the actual production condition. The optimization design of selecting machining method is achieved.
